C/C++ support for Visual Studio Code is provided by a Microsoft C/C++ extension to enable cross-platform C and C++ development on Windows, Linux, and macOS.
Simplest C compiler for MACOs? Im teaching my brother basic programming (i know, C is far from basic but he wants to do arduino projects and it's the only language i know aside from ladder anyway).
C/C++ compiler and debugger
The C/C++ extension does not include a C++ compiler or debugger. You will need to install these tools or use those already installed on your computer.
Popular C++ compilers are:
If you see a message in the Outbox folder, make sure your connection is working.The item is too old. Many email accounts are set up to only synchronize sent items for a certain period of time. The message could not be sent because it has unresolved recipients. error code -50. Search by using keywords used in the message or by using someone’s name. If the email message isn't sent successfully, for example because of connectivity problems or logon issues, it might be stuck in your Outbox folder. To narrow your search to a specific person or subject line, try typing To: or Subject.I can't find an item in my Sent Items folderThere are several reasons why an item might not appear in your Sent Items folder.The item hasn't been sent yet.
- GCC on Linux
- GCC via Mingw-w64 on Windows
- Microsoft C++ compiler on Windows
- Clang for XCode on macOS
Make sure your compiler executable is in your platform path so the extension can find it. You can check availability of your C++ tools by opening the Integrated Terminal (⌃` (Windows, Linux Ctrl+`)) in VS Code and try running the executable (for example
Install the Microsoft C/C++ extension
- Open VS Code.
- Click the Extensions view icon on the Sidebar (⇧⌘X (Windows, Linux Ctrl+Shift+X)).
- Search for
- Click Install.
Hello World tutorials
Get started with C++ and VS Code with Hello World tutorials for your environment:
You can find more documentation on using the Microsoft C/C++ extension under the C++ section, where you'll find topics on:
VS Code and the C++ extension support Remote Development allowing you to work over SSH on a remote machine or VM, inside a Docker container, or in the Windows Subsystem for Linux (WSL).
It’s fast, secure and what else can I say? Teamviewer 6 for mac.
To install support for Remote Development:
- Install the VS Code Remote Development Extension Pack.
- If the remote source files are hosted in WSL, use the Remote - WSL extension.
- If you are connecting to a remote machine with SSH, use the Remote - SSH extension.
- If the remote source files are hosted in a container (for example, Docker), use the Remote - Containers extension.
If you run into any issues or have suggestions for the Microsoft C/C++ extension, please file issues and suggestions on GitHub. If you haven't already provided feedback, please take this quick survey to help shape this extension for your needs.